Output 83aeddbe448738ebdee943963daca94016932c7480d7214c3fa4047e45942518:42

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51743709825b73a3ca84e6120688e3c0f89c33861eddfff16f487b203b403b43
address
tb1p296rwzvztde68j5yucfqdz8rcrufcvuxrmwllut0fpajqw6q8dpsgjyyjz
transaction
83aeddbe448738ebdee943963daca94016932c7480d7214c3fa4047e45942518
confirmations
24038
spent
true